Mysql启动报错如下:

[root@db01 opt]# service mysqld start

Starting MySQL.... ERROR! The server quit without updating PID file (/opt/mysql-5.6.24/data/mysql.pid).

查看错误日志,发现问题根源在于下面红色部分:

2017-08-26 01:45:44 8525 [Note] InnoDB: Initializing buffer pool, size = 256.0M

2017-08-26 01:45:44 8525 [Note] InnoDB: Completed initialization of buffer pool

2017-08-26 01:45:44 8525 [Note] InnoDB: Highest supported file format is Barracuda.

2017-08-26 01:45:44 8525 [Note] InnoDB: 128 rollback segment(s) are active.

2017-08-26 01:45:44 8525 [Note] InnoDB: Waiting for purge to start

2017-08-26 01:45:44 8525 [Note] InnoDB: 5.6.24 started; log sequence number 1626194

2017-08-26 01:45:44 8525 [ERROR] --gtid-mode=ON or UPGRADE_STEP_1 requires --enforce-gtid-consistency

2017-08-26 01:45:44 8525 [ERROR] Aborting

2017-08-26 01:45:44 8525 [Note] Binlog end

2017-08-26 01:45:44 8525 [Note] Shutting down plugin 'rpl_semi_sync_slave'

2017-08-26 01:45:44 8525 [Note] Shutting down plugin 'rpl_semi_sync_master'

2017-08-26 01:45:44 8525 [Note] unregister_replicator OK

2017-08-26 01:45:44 8525 [Note] Shutting down plugin 'partition'

2017-08-26 01:45:44 8525 [Note] Shutting down plugin 'PERFORMANCE_SCHEMA'

2017-08-26 01:45:44 8525 [Note] Shutting down plugin 'BLACKHOLE'

2017-08-26 01:45:44 8525 [Note] Shutting down plugin 'INNODB_SYS_DATAFILES'

解决办法:将/etc/my.cnf文件参数注释掉:

#gtid-mode = ON

#enforce-gtid-consistency = 1

重新启动mysql,成功。

MySQL5.6启动报错The server quit without updating PID file的更多相关文章

  1. mysql启动报错 The server quit without updating PID file

    [root@uz6542 data]# /etc/init.d/mysqld startStarting MySQL... ERROR! The server quit without updatin ...

  2. mysql启动报错The server quit without updating PID file

    现网mysql无法启动是很让人头疼的,数据很有可能恢复不了,解决方法如下: 查看mysql目录下的日志,根据日志来锁定错误原因(mysql的错误日志很抽象) a.如果日志不能提供任何帮助则可进行以下步 ...

  3. lnmp下启动mysql报错 The server quit without updating PID file

    启动时候错误代码:Starting MySQL[FAIL.] The server quit without updating PID file (/var/run/mysqld/mysqld.pid ...

  4. Mysql启动报错 The server quit without updating PID

    [root@db mysql]# service mysql restartMySQL server PID file could not be found![失败]Starting MySQL... ...

  5. Mysql启动失败 MYSQL:The server quit without updating PID file

    MySQL5.6启动时出错 提示MYSQL:The server quit without updating PID file 首先执行 /bin/mysqld_safe --user=mysql & ...

  6. 启动mysqld报 mysql the server quit without updating pid file

    查看mysql服务器的错误日志有一句: InnoDB: mmap(137363456 bytes) failed; errno 12 原来是内存不够用(需要131MB)呀,把my.cnf中的innod ...

  7. 启动MySql提示:The server quit without updating PID file(…)失败

    1.可能是/usr/local/mysql/data/rekfan.pid文件没有写的权限解决方法 :给予权限,执行 "chown -R mysql:mysql /var/data" ...

  8. 数据库启动失败:The server quit without updating PID file

    1.可能是/usr/local/mysql/data/mysql.pid文件没有写的权限解决方法 :给予权限,执行 “chown -R mysql:mysql /var/data” “chmod -R ...

  9. 缺乏libaio包导致报The server quit without updating PID file

    背景: 直接解压安装mysql5.7.18,解压mysql-5.7.18-linux-glibc2.5-x86_64.tar.gz,直接拷贝另外一台数据库的数据目录,启动mysql过程无日志输出,报E ...

随机推荐

  1. 二值化函数cvThreshold()参数CV_THRESH_OTSU的疑惑【转】

    查看OpenCV文档cvThreshold(),在二值化函数cvThreshold(const CvArr* src, CvArr* dst, double threshold, double max ...

  2. Github忽略keil工程生成的链接、编译等文件

    *.bak *.ddk *.edk *.lst *.lnp *.mpf *.mpj *.obj *.omf *.plg *.rpt *.tmp *.__i *.crf *.o *.d *.axf *. ...

  3. 【Vegas原创】SQL Server 只安装客户端的方法

    只安装管理工具

  4. android sdk manager 代理设置

    启动 Android SDK Manager ,打开主界面,依次选择「Tools」.「Options...」,弹出『Android SDK Manager - Settings』窗口: 在『Andro ...

  5. batch,iteration,epoch 什么意思

    深度学习中经常看到epoch. iteration和batchsize,下面按自己的理解说说这三个的区别: (1)batchsize:批大小.在深度学习中,一般采用SGD训练,即每次训练在训练集中取b ...

  6. JVM 内部原理(二)— 基本概念之字节码

    JVM 内部原理(二)- 基本概念之字节码 介绍 版本:Java SE 7 每位使用 Java 的程序员都知道 Java 字节码在 Java 运行时(JRE - Java Runtime Enviro ...

  7. centos7安装elasticsearch-head

    elasticsearch-head安装前准备 1.操作系统64位CentOS Linux release 7.2.1511 (Core)2.git是必需的elasticsearch-head是一款开 ...

  8. Java 同时返回多个不同类型的方法

    Java 同时返回多个不同类型的方法 2016年12月02日 16:05:07 FXBStudy 阅读数:10045   前言:虽然对于这种需求不常用,且比较冷门,但是还是有其存在的价值,再次做一下整 ...

  9. 性能优化系列八:MYSQL的配置优化

    一.关键配置 1. 配置文件的位置 MySQL配置文件 /etc/my.cnf 或者 /etc/my.cnf.d/server.cnf 几个关键的文件:.pid文件,记录了进程id.sock文件,是内 ...

  10. DOS、Mac 和 Unix 文件格式+ UltraEdit使用

    文件格式 区分DOS.Mac 和 Unix分别对应三种系统 从文件编码的方式来看,文件可分为ASCII码文件和二进制码文件两种 文件模式 区分ASCII模式和Binary模式  通常由系统决定,大多数 ...